Manager, Product Management Overview:

At Mastercard Checkout Services, we're on a mission to revolutionize online payments by making them more straightforward, efficient, and secure. Our commitment to innovation is evident in our suite of products, including Click to Pay, Secure Card on File Tokenization, and Token Authentication Service, all designed to create seamless digital payment experiences at scale.

We're seeking a seasoned Product Manager for our Merchant Card on File Tokenization team, focusing on Merchant - Token Lifecycle Management. This role will collaborate with global stakeholders to refine and advance our Merchant - token lifecycle processes.

The ideal candidate will be passionate about enhancing B2B customer experiences, demonstrate unwavering motivation, possess intellectual curiosity, and maintain a data-driven analytical approach. Strong teamwork skills and the ability to work across geographical time zones are essential for this role.

Our vision is a future where every transaction is secured with a tokenized credential, and we're looking for the right person to join us to achieve this.



Role:

Participate in the development and execution of COF Token Lifecycle product strategy.

Detect and address customer challenges, devising strategies to facilitate customer adoption and effective utilization of our product suite.

Forge partnerships with customers, client-facing teams, internal development teams, and various teams at Mastercard to introduce enhancements that solidify Token Lifecycle management.

Drive the innovation and refinement of new and existing products to align with customer demands.

Elevate the Tokenization value proposition through strategic product development.
